This evaluation will certainly focus on evidence for the application of the initial three approaches when spaces are inhabited. Of these methods, upper-room UVGI has actually been used for more than 70 years to lower transmission of virus such as tuberculosis (TB). The studies in this testimonial cover different UVGI innovations that can be made use of in areas with individuals existing, including UV-C lamps that are wall-mounted, UV-C ceiling followers, and portable UV-C air cleaners.
9 studies were included, 9 reporting on the performance (See Evidence Table 1-3) and two reporting on the safety and security (Table 4) of UVGI innovations to lower SARS-CoV-2 in the air of busy rooms. The proof was from simulation (n=8) and empirical (n=1) research studies and general the degree of evidence in this testimonial is thought about reduced.
Both the wall installed and ceiling fan components have decontaminating UV-C lamps that intend up at the ceiling. These technologies were efficient in minimizing SARS-CoV-2 airborne of busy rooms in both observational (n=1) and simulation (n=6) researches. A Russian hospital reported just area obtained COVID-19 instances among personnel April to June 2020 and no transmission among clients to personnel in healthcare facility areas with wall-mounted top space UVGI components (low-pressure mercury lamps, 254 nm).

This included an area examination and a simulation research. High level points are listed here and information on individual studies can be found in Table 4. An area examination from Russia reported that upper area UVGI low-pressure mercury lamps (254 nm, 30 W) utilized 1 day a day, 7 days a week, in occupied health center areas were secure.
The higher the UVGI light is situated on the wall, the lower the threat of over-exposure. If the ceiling height is 2.74 m, a UVGI lamp placing elevation of 2.29 m leads to a lowered level of UV-C radiation reflected right into the lower zone of the room, compared to a mounting elevation of 2.13 m.
When both UVGI lights were situated on one long wall of the area, it caused the most affordable danger of overexposure. D'Alessandro (2021) Simulation study Italy Mar 2021 An EulerianLagrangian version was developed to analyze the impact of UV-C irradiation on inactivation of airborne virus/bacteria fragments in a cloud of saliva beads. Clouds created from one, two, and three coughing ejections were modelled.
In the version, the radiation dosage adequate to inactivate SARS-CoV-2 was used as the "vulnerability consistent" for the virus/bacteria (8.5281 x 10-2 m2/J). UV-C irradiation was shown to properly inactivate most of SARS-CoV-2 particles in a cloud of saliva droplets after 4 secs. The UV-C light with a power of 55 W was much more efficient at inactivating SARS-CoV-2 over a duration of 10 secs compared to 25 W.
